## Configuration

The Ledgerline payment retrier derives idempotency keys from the order ID plus a rotating namespace, so duplicate charge attempts during a release are collapsed server-side. Release managers should set RETRY_NAMESPACE_EPOCH in `.env` at each cutover and confirm RETRY_MAX_ATTEMPTS matches the gateway contract (currently 5). Keys are HMAC-signed before transmission to the Wexbourne clearing API, and the signing credential is set on the next line of the env file.

vault entry, yahif-yajep: COURIER_KEY29=b802bdf8034096b65a51c6ba5abe2

This PR addresses clock skew between the Marrowgate build agents that caused artifact timestamps to land out of order, breaking the Pellinor release pipeline's staleness checks. Changes: agents now sync against the internal Thornquist time service at job start, and the scheduler rejects agents drifting beyond a configurable threshold rather than silently reordering. No changes to artifact format. Safe to merge ahead of the 4.2 cut; rollback is a single flag flip. The skew-handling constants introduced here are the following.

tuning constants:
QUOTAS = {
    "druwyn": 5,
    "holix": 5,
    "zorath": 5,
    "holwyn": 10,
}

## Runbook: SDK parity — Lanternkit iOS vs Android

We keep the Lanternkit iOS and Android SDKs feature-matched via a parity manifest checked on every release. If the parity gate fails, one SDK shipped a capability the other lacks — usually auth scopes or the new pinned-cert handling. Heads up for security review: parity failures can silently disable cert pinning on the lagging platform, which is the thing we actually care about. The gate compares each build against the manifest values listed here.

config for tagep-yajef:
ulawyn:
  log_level: error
  metrics_host: metrics.ulawyn.lumiclabs.internal
  pin: 0564
  pool_size: 32

Handover note — Crumbwheel order cutoffs.

Welcome aboard. The bakery cutoff rule in Crumbwheel closes same-day orders at 14:00 local to each storefront, not UTC — this has bitten us twice. Holiday overrides live in the calendar service and take precedence silently, so always check there first when a cutoff looks wrong. To unlock the calendar service's admin console after a restart, enter the recovery passphrase below.

vault phrase of bagap-bahaf = silion-pelox-sorox-casdor-quenwyn-fraax-eliox-praael-kelion-quenvan-kasox-rusael-norius-belvan